AWS云服务器虚拟主机部署与管理指南

虚拟主机 0

AWS云服务器虚拟主机部署与管理指南

在数字化转型浪潮中,企业上云已成为提升业务灵活性的关键选择。然而,许多用户在初次接触AWS云服务器时,常面临​​部署流程复杂​​、​​资源配置不当​​、​​运维成本高​​等痛点。如何快速搭建稳定高效的虚拟主机环境?本文将提供一套经过验证的实践方案。


为什么选择AWS作为虚拟主机平台?

AWS全球市场份额占比超30%(2025年最新数据),其优势不仅在于基础设施的稳定性,更体现在​​弹性扩展能力​​和​​丰富的服务生态​​。与其他云平台相比,AWS EC2实例提供:

AWS云服务器虚拟主机部署与管理指南

  • ​90+种实例类型​​:从计算优化型到内存优化型,满足不同业务负载

  • ​按秒计费模式​​:相比传统物理服务器节省40%以上成本

  • ​全球25个区域覆盖​​:实现低延迟跨国部署

一个常见误区是认为"所有应用都适合迁移到云"。实际上,​​高频IO的数据库服务​​可能更适合专用硬件,而Web应用、微服务等场景才是AWS虚拟主机的优势领域。


四步完成EC2实例部署

1. 实例配置选择黄金法则

登录AWS控制台创建EC2实例时,关键决策点包括:

  • ​操作系统​​:Amazon Linux 2025镜像已预装AWS CLI和Python3,比Ubuntu节省20%配置时间

  • ​实例规格​​:

    • 小型博客:t3.micro(1vCPU/1GiB内存)

    • 电商网站:m6i.large(2vCPU/8GiB内存)

    • 视频处理:c6g.2xlarge(8vCPU/16GiB内存)

  • ​存储优化​​:默认8GB SSD往往不够,建议生产环境至少配置​​30GB GP2卷​

​实践建议​​:使用​​Launch Template​​保存常用配置,可缩短后续部署时间至3分钟以内。

2. 网络与安全组配置实战

安全组相当于虚拟防火墙,必须遵循最小权限原则:

markdown复制
| 应用类型       | 入站规则                     | 出站规则          |
|----------------|------------------------------|-------------------|
| Web服务器      | HTTP 80/TCP, HTTPS 443/TCP   | 全开              |
| 数据库服务器   | 仅开放内网3306端口            | 特定IP段访问      |

​关键点​​:务必限制SSH 22端口的访问IP范围,避免暴露在公网风险。


高效管理五大核心技巧

1. 自动化运维工具链

通过以下工具实现"无人值守"管理:

  • ​AWS Systems Manager​​:批量执行命令、自动打补丁

  • ​CloudWatch警报​​:设置CPU>80%自动触发扩容

  • ​Terraform模板​​:基础设施即代码(IaC)管理

2. 成本控制三板斧

  • ​Spot实例​​:非关键业务可节省70%费用

  • ​预留实例​​:长期稳定负载建议1年期预付

  • ​Cost Explorer​​:分析服务占比,识别"资源吸血鬼"


故障排查与性能优化

当遇到服务器响应延迟时,建议按此顺序排查:

  1. ​CloudWatch监控​​:检查CPU/内存/磁盘IOPS是否触顶

  2. ​连接数检测​​:netstat -ant | grep ESTABLISHED | wc -l

  3. ​应用日志分析​​:ELK堆栈实现日志可视化

​独家数据​​:AWS技术团队统计显示,80%的性能问题源于​​错误的安全组规则​​和​​未优化的存储配置​​。


未来三年,边缘计算与AWS Outposts的结合将重塑虚拟主机部署模式。建议开发者现在就开始积累​​混合云管理​​经验,这将成为下一个技术竞争高地。最新案例显示,采用AWS Local Zones部署的在线教育平台,其视频流延迟已降至80ms以内。